草庐IT

csv-import

全部标签

C++实现读取csv格式的数据集到数组里

在C++中,可以使用标准库中的iostream和fstream头文件来读取CSV格式的数据集。下面是一个基本的示例代码:#include#include#include#includeusingnamespacestd;intmain(){ifstreamfile("data.csv");vectorvectorstring>>data;stringline;while(getline(file,line)){vectorstring>row;size_tpos=0;stringtoken;while((pos=line.find(","))!=string::npos){token=line

python利用pandas和csv包两种方式向一个csv文件写入或追加数据

1.使用pandasimportpandasa={"姓名":['张三','李四'],"年龄":[23,25]}data=pandas.DataFrame(a)#a需要是字典格式#mode='a'表示追加,index=True表示给每行数据加索引序号,header=False表示不加标题data.to_csv("test1.csv",mode='a',index=False,header=True)或者importpandasa=[['张三',23],['李四',25]]data=pandas.DataFrame(data=a)##mode='a'表示追加,index=True表示给每行数据加索

使用vite-plugin-style-import插件报错Cannot find module ‘consola‘和解决方法

使用的Vite创建的项目,使用 unplugin-vue-components 来进行按需加载。但是此插件无法处理非组件模块,如message,这种组件需要手动加载,如:import{message}from'ant-design-vue'import'ant-design-vue/es/message/style/css'由于已按需导入了组件库,因此仅样式不是按需导入的,因此只需按需导入样式即可。使用 vite-plugin-style-import 可以帮助我们按需引入样式安装:npmivite-plugin-style-import-D//或者yarnaddvite-plugin-sty

flutter - 状态小部件 : Which import and does it matter?

如果我创建一个新的SatefulWidget,我可以导入3个不同的文件:我使用哪个导入有关系吗?或者,如果我在我的应用程序中的小部件之间切换并且每个小部件使用不同的导入,这是一个问题吗? 最佳答案 你可以使用它们中的任何一个,在两个文件中它指向相同的摘要class.但是,为了提高可读性,您应该使用已经导入到文件中的文件。 关于flutter-状态小部件:Whichimportanddoesitmatter?,我们在StackOverflow上找到一个类似的问题:

flutter - 状态小部件 : Which import and does it matter?

如果我创建一个新的SatefulWidget,我可以导入3个不同的文件:我使用哪个导入有关系吗?或者,如果我在我的应用程序中的小部件之间切换并且每个小部件使用不同的导入,这是一个问题吗? 最佳答案 你可以使用它们中的任何一个,在两个文件中它指向相同的摘要class.但是,为了提高可读性,您应该使用已经导入到文件中的文件。 关于flutter-状态小部件:Whichimportanddoesitmatter?,我们在StackOverflow上找到一个类似的问题:

PL/SQL 中的数据导入和导出:CSV 文件格式详解

系列文章目录文章目录系列文章目录前言一、导出数据到CSV文件:二、导入CSV文件数据:总结前言在PL/SQL开发中,数据的导入和导出是常见的操作。本文将深入探讨如何使用PL/SQL导入和导出CSV文件格式的数据,帮助你轻松地实现数据迁移、备份和数据交换等需求。CSV(Comma-SeparatedValues)是一种常见的文本文件格式,它以逗号作为字段的分隔符,每行表示一个记录。使用CSV格式可以方便地在不同的系统之间共享和传输数据。下面我们将分步介绍如何在PL/SQL中导入和导出CSV文件格式的数据。一、导出数据到CSV文件:要将数据导出为CSV文件,可以使用PL/SQL的UTL_FILE包

Python之xlsx文件与csv文件相互转换

Python之xlsx文件与csv文件相互转换在Python中,可以使用xlrd和csv模块来处理Excel文件和csv文件。xlsx文件转csv文件importxlrdimportcsvdefxlsx_to_csv():workbook=xlrd.open_workbook('1.xlsx')table=workbook.sheet_by_index(0)withcodecs.open('1.csv','w',encoding='utf-8')asf:write=csv.writer(f)forrow_numinrange(table.nrows):row_value=table.row_v

解决:使用前端路由时的报错Cannot destructure property ‘options’ of ‘(0 , vue__WEBPACK_IMPORTED_MODULE_1__.inject)

使用前端路由时,代码无误,但是页面不显示任何东西,控制台报错:Cannotdestructureproperty‘options’of‘(0,vue__WEBPACK_IMPORTED_MODULE_1__.inject)(…)’asitisundefined.解决:step1:删掉下图所示目录node_modules(需要管理员身份)step2运行命令npmi,重新生成上述目录step3运行:npmrundev/serve(根据自己的配置文件来)最终就可以得到期望的效果啦

Vue3自动引入组件(unplugin-auto-import和element-plus)

前言在使用Vue3开发项目时,我们经常需要引入多个组件,但是每次手动引入非常麻烦,容易出错。为了解决这个问题,我们可以使用unplugin-auto-import插件自动引入组件,提高开发效率。本篇博客将详细介绍如何在Vue3项目中使用unplugin-auto-import插件。安装插件首先,在项目中安装unplugin-auto-import插件:npminstall-Dunplugin-auto-import@next配置插件在项目根目录下创建vite.config.js文件,然后配置插件:import{defineConfig}from'vite';importvuefrom'@vit

python使用pd.read_csv(),出现错误UnicodeDecodeError: ‘utf-8‘ codec can‘t decode ......

首先说一下这个原因,所读取的csv文件的编码方式不是utf-8,然后现在指定encoding="UTF-8"会出现以上问题。一、查看你的csv文件时什么编码方式使用记事本打开csv文件,红框所示即csv文件的编码方式。现在你的csv文件的编码格式就是"ANSI",这时候再去指定encoding="UTF-8",就会报错。二、两种解决方法1、使用"ANSI"格式读取CSV文件将你的程序改为:pd.read_csv("你文件的地址"(例如:"1.csv"),"encoding="ANSI")注意:ANSI只是windows系统的编码格式,mac系统没有这个编码格式,我们在使用kaggle等免费gp